Opinion
[329]*329Opinion by
In accordance with stipulation of counsel that the merchandise consists of silk wearing apparel similar in all material respects to that the subject of United States v. The Specialty Home, Inc., Bryant & Heffernan, Inc., et al. (42 C.C.P.A. 136, C.A.D. 685), the claim of the plaintiff was sustained.
